Leicester Corporation is to help the Archaeological Society to excavate for the tomb of Cardinal Wolscy, who died at Leicester Abbey. In a railway carriage recently in London a gentleman of prosperous but unprepossessing appearance _ was much flattered to see a man opposite hirh take a notebook out of his pocket, watch him closely, a:»cl start vigorously sketching. The young man returned the notebook io his pocket, and the other, getting into conversation, sam, “Artist, sir, I presume?” “Well,” said the other, “I suppose 7 might describe myself as such. As a matter of fact, I’m a designer for door knockers.” The world’s largest barrel, which will hold 625,000 gallons, has recently been made in Germany-
